There are numerous silkworkshops and a couple more handicraftemporia along main Sagaing road in Amarapura(p 224 ). Puppets are sold at MoustacheBrothers and Mandalay Marionettes.Good-value items can be found at the stonecarvers’ workshops (p 209 ), and there areseveral interesting shops on 36th St besidethe gold-leaf-pounding workshops (p 209 ).Shwe PatheinSOUVENIRS(Map p 202 ; No 141 36th St, 77/78; h8am-5pm) SellsPathein-style parasols (K4000 to K8000) andbark animal portraits (from K4000).RockySOUVENIRS(Map p 204 ; Sein Win Myint; 27th St, 62/63; h8am-9pm) Various handicrafts including stuffed‘gold-thread’ tapestries, plus gems and jade.Sut NgaiFABRIC(Map p 206 ; 33rd St, 82/83) Sells Kachin fabricsand costumes, aimed mainly at Kachinsthemselves rather than tourists.MarketsZeigyoMARKET(Map p 206 ; 84th St, 26/28) This downtownmarket offers wall-to-wall stands selling justabout everything Myanmar. The Chinesecommunist-style architecture dates from theearly 1990s after a disastrous 1988 fire destroyedan earlier model. This market shouldbe replaced in a few years by a vast 25-storeytower mall, currently under construction.Night marketMARKET(Map p 206 ; 84th St, 26/29) Vendors sellingfood, music, army hats and clothes importedfrom China block off the street as dusk approaches– a worthy wander.8InformationInternet AccessInternet cafes are fairly common along 27th Stand are scattered widely around the city centre,but most are appallingly slow.Acme-Net (Map p 206 ; 26th St, 78/79; per hrK500; h9am-9pm) Better connection thanmost and adept with proxy servers.Dream Land (Map p 204 ; 27th St, 72/73; per hrK400; h9.30am-<strong>11</strong>pm; a) Good connectionand AC, free drinking water.MoneyEXCHANGE Most guesthouses will change pristineUS$ cash, but for rates approaching Yangonlevels, ask at gold shops such as Shwe HinnThar (26th St 84/85; h10am-4pm), beside theclock tower, or travel agencies such as SevenDiamond Express (Map p 206 ; %22365; 32ndSt, 82/83). Marie-Min vegetarian restaurantalso offers decent rates.CREDIT CARDS Nowhere in Mandalay givescash advances. If you’re out of dollars and needa room, the Mandalay View Inn and the Hotel bythe Red Canal accept credit cards at 10% commissionif you pay one day ahead.PostDHL (Hotel Mandalay, 78th St, 37/38;h8.30am-5.30pm Mon-Fri, 8.30am-12.30pmSat) Costs from $80 for the cheapestdocument-only package to Europe.Main post office (Map p 206 ; 22nd St, 80/81;h10.30am-4pm)TelephoneLocal/national calls cost K100/200 per minutefrom PCO street stands. Royal Guest House andRoyal City Hotel both offer international calls for$2 per minute.CTT Telephone Office (Map p 206 ; 25th St,80/81; calls to Europe/Australasia/NorthAmerica per min $4/4/5; h7am-8.30pm)Anonymous-looking room for expensive internationalcalls.Tourist Information & Travel AgenciesDaw San San Aye (Map p 206 ; %31799; HotelDynasty, 81st St, 24/25; h7.30am-8pm) Veryobliging, fair-priced air-ticket sales booth.Seven Diamond (Map p206 ; %30128, 72828;82nd St, 26/27; h8am-9pm) Helpful agency thatcan pre-book flights by email request, changemoney at good rates and organise airport-boundshared taxis. Henry speaks great English.M T T (Map p 204 ; %60356; 68th at 27th St;h9am-5pm) The government-run travelcompany doubles as tourist office selling citymaps (K200) as well as transport tickets andpermit-needing tours.
